What “community” ability in useful terms

A service network is the reduced in size neighborhood of medical professionals, hospitals, labs, rehab facilities, and pharmacies that agree to the plan’s money terms. In Cape Coral, this can incorporate renowned names like Lee Health, Cape Coral Hospital, and surgeon teams clustered along Del Prado and Pine Island Road. The kind of Medicare plan you settle upon dictates how tightly you are tethered to that list.

Original Medicare with Part A and Part B works nationwide with out a network in the HMO sense. You can see any issuer who accepts Medicare, which maximum hospitals and a considerable majority of physicians do. If you pair it with a Medigap policy and a Part D prescription plan, your “community” limitations almost always prove up in the Part D formulary and pharmacy arrangements, now not in your scientific services.

Medicare Advantage, in spite of this, is community-centric. HMO plans almost always require referrals and have strict in-community regulation other than for emergencies. PPO plans supply greater flexibility out of network, but at bigger settlement. Private Fee-for-Service plans look from time to time and may also be quirky approximately which companies be given the phrases. Special Needs Plans, designed for laborers with particular power illnesses or Medicaid eligibility, steadily concentrate care through unique service corporations.

What are the three requirements for Medicare?

Medicare eligibility widely rests on 3 pillars:

  • Age or qualifying circumstance: You’re 65 or older, or you’ve got Social Security Disability Insurance for in any case 24 months, or you've got you have got End-Stage Renal Disease or ALS.
  • Legal prestige: You are a U.S. citizen or a lawful permanent resident who has lived in the U.S. continuously for in any case 5 years.
  • Work records or spouse’s work heritage for top rate-unfastened Part A: You, or your partner, have at the very least 40 quarters, more or less 10 years, of Medicare-blanketed employment. If now not, you are able to nonetheless enroll, however Part A would possibly carry a per thirty days premium.

Remember that Part B has a separate top rate no matter your paintings heritage. If you put off Part B without qualifying service provider neighborhood insurance, past due enrollment consequences can practice.

Is Medicare loose at age sixty five?

Medicare is not very entirely loose at 65. Here is the apparent breakdown for maximum americans in Lee County:

  • Part A is more commonly top rate-unfastened for those who or your better half have forty quarters of protected work. It still has a deductible, which resets in step with receive advantages interval for hospital stays.
  • Part B has a per thirty days top rate. The widely used top class is set yearly and would be decreased for some americans with extra assist or increased in the event that your profits is above distinct thresholds due to the IRMAA, the profit-linked monthly adjustment amount.
  • Part D prescription insurance plan includes its possess top rate except you pick out a Medicare Advantage plan that entails drug protection. Drug quotes fluctuate by means of formulary tier and pharmacy popularity.
  • Medigap insurance policies require a separate premium. They assist cover Part A and Part B check sharing.
  • Medicare Advantage plans may additionally have low or zero charges, however they come with copays and an annual out-of-pocket highest. Some embrace extras like dental or imaginative and prescient, funded in part with the aid of controlled care efficiencies and CMS payments.

Anyone telling you Medicare is free at 65 is either oversimplifying or promoting one thing. It’s low priced in contrast with such a lot lower than-sixty five insurance, however it entails premiums, deductibles, and copays.

Medicare Enrollment Cape Coral: timing and penalties

Medicare Enrollment in Cape Coral follows the equal guidelines as anywhere within the U.S., but the stakes are entrance and midsection in a place full of new retirees. Enroll in Part A and Part B in the course of your Initial Enrollment Period except you've qualifying employer crew insurance that helps a Part B extend. If you leave out your window and lack creditable assurance, you're able to be stuck watching for the General Enrollment Period and a July 1 constructive date, plus a Part B late enrollment penalty that lasts as long as you've gotten Medicare.

Medicare Open Enrollment Cape Coral, from October 15 to December 7, is your annual opportunity to modify prescription coverage, transfer between Medicare Advantage plans, or move between Medicare Advantage and Original Medicare. If you're deliberating a shift from Medicare Advantage returned to Original Medicare and prefer a Medigap plan, understand that that during Florida, Medigap insurers always underwrite out of doors sure secure home windows. Your well being heritage can have an impact on popularity and fee. This is a key area case many laborers find too late.
